They work! Having owned a CZ 455 with a Lilja and settling on Eley Black, I can confirm that they work.
The rifle I did it with went from averaging .5’s with factory barrel, to .3’s with Lilja, to .2’s with the tuner and same exact lot. I’m talking 6x5 average and not cherry picked groups. I had pulled off a few without it, but it consistently performed better with the tuner.

There is a reason real benchrest guys use them on even more exotic setups. All depends on what you are trying to squeak out of it. Sure it isn’t needed for a 2moa metal target at 50 yards, but if you are trying to hit the x every time every time, you take every ounce of improvement in consistency you can find.
